S7-200 SMART 在全自动金属带锯床上的应用
上海赞国自动化科技有限公司
摘 要:本文介绍 S7-200 SMART PLC 在全自动金属带锯床上的应用,阐述了设备工艺要求、控制系统配置、软
件设计和实现的功能。经测试,该方案性能稳定,加工精度满足设计要求。
关键词:S7-200 SMART 金属带锯床
1 引言
日常生活中各种产品的生产和模具都有着密不可分的联系,而金属带锯床是在模具加工中的**道生产工
序,它将钢厂生产出来的金属板材、棒材、管材加工成其它生产过程中所需的小块材料。
早在 20 世纪中后期,金属带锯床就已经大量出现。随着轴承工业及汽车工业的发展,大批量等长度加工
生产要求的产生,全自动金属带锯床开始出现,当时的控制系统多采用单片机控制,但不利于后期的功能升级,
同时维护成本较高。
随着 PLC 和人机界面技术的普及,由于其开放的性能和操作的简便性受到越来越多的认可,PLC 成为金
属带锯床的主流控制器而得到广泛应用。
2 全自动金属带锯床工艺要求
2.1 全自动金属带锯床结构
全自动金属带锯床由以下几部分组成:
(1) 油压控制系统,主要提供整机液化气压控制动力。
(2) 带前、后夹钳的自动送料床台系统,前夹钳和后夹钳主要对需要加工材料起夹紧的固定作用,由液压提供
动力,同时当一根完整材料加工完成后通过压力自动检测停机功能也是由夹钳的动作产生的信号;送料床
台部分执行材料运送及定寸功能,也是由液压提供动力,当送料床台前进送料及后退定寸时,通过小齿轮
带动旋转编码器转动,编码器反馈的高速脉冲输入到 S7-200 SMART 的高速计数器 HSC0 进行计数 N,通过
L=2πR,计算出编码器小齿轮转动一周的周长,同时⊿L=L/PPR(PPR 为编码器分辩率)。当实际所需的定寸
长度为 l 时,PLC 应接收的脉冲个数是 n=l/⊿L,当 N=n 时定位完成。
(3) 锯框及主马达,锯框带动金属带锯条升降,主马达为带锯条旋转提供动力,主马达由变频器控制,起到节
能和调速的功能,锯框的升降由油缸带动,通过压力调节阀和流量调节阀控制锯框锯切不同材料时的压力
和不同材料及不同锯带转速时的下降速度。4 软件设计
4.1 高速计数配置
S7-200 SMART 集成了4 路高速计数器,在本系统中只使用了高速计数器HSC0,用来接收当前送料床台位置反馈
脉冲,选择工作模式9,计数倍率为4倍,预设值地址:VD8004,当前值地址:VD8000,当事件 12 (HC0 的 CV = PV) 启
用中断并启动计数器。注意:在使用高速计数器时,请在系统块中将相对应的数字量输入的滤波时间改成0.2ms,如不修
改则高速计数器将不能正常工作,本配置中将I0.0和I0.1滤波时间改成0.2ms。
4.2 工作数据存贮
应客户要求,做到100个工作站,将常用的100种加工长度和数量记录起来,方便使用,因TK6070I的配方在实际使
用上操作人员很不习惯且不好操作,通过使用其项目选单功能来配合S7-200 SMART的指针进行间接寻址功能,很轻易
的实现了客户的要求,所占用地址从VD0-VD2396。
4.3 程序功能的实现
按照程实现的功能主要分成以下几部分
(1) 主程序部分 OB1,用来调用子程和手动控制程序及输出处理。(2) 自动工艺控制部分 SBR0,按照图 2 工艺流程编制程序。
(3) 配方及选单功能 SBR1,通过 S7-200 SMART 的指针进行间接寻址功能,轻松实现 100 个工作站的数据存
贮和调用,编程简便,数据处理量少,节省了大量的工作量。
(4) 人机数据处理及报警功工能 SBR2,主要处理中英文、及厘米英寸转换、锯带转速计算和报警处理。
(5) 送料长度计算 SBR3,主要实现每次送料长度的计算,及设置长度下的送料次数,同时处理送料**过较大
允许误差时停机功能。
5 结束语
S7-200 SMART 硬件设计采用输入在上部,输出在下部,使现场人员更*适应,配线更加方便。在编程过
程中向上、向下及向右的画线可方便的使用 Ctrl+方向键,不需再用鼠标一个一个的点击,操作简便。通过一根
普通的网线即可完成程序的下载,不需配备**下载电缆,下载速度快,几秒钟完成工程的下载,同时增加了
下载选项的快捷按钮,方便实用。
本系统没有采用伺服电机带动送料机构,改成油缸推动送料机构,编码器反馈位置信号,从而大大的节省
的控制和机械结构的成本,重复定位精度满足生产需求,采用 S7-200 SMART PLC 提升了设备档次,提高了整机
控制系统的稳定性,大量节了了售后成本,得到客户的一至**。
S7-200 SMART 在化成生产线上的应用
上海赞国自动化科技有限公司 黄工 西门子(中国)有限公司 黄坤
设计了基于 S7-200 SMART 的化成生产线监控系统,介绍了系统架构、硬件
选型及软件设计方案。在通信方面, S7-200 SMART 通过自由口通讯的方式采集
一条生产线上的所有仪表的数据,然后再通过工业以太网的方式把所有生产线的
数据传送到上位机,实现了现场数据的实时监控。经现场长时间运行,系统运行
稳定、高效,很好地满足了客户需求。
化成生产线是将阳极电蚀铝箔置于化成液中,利用电气化学原理,使阳极电
蚀铝箔表面生产氧化膜,此过程称为化成。
工艺流程
化成工艺流程为:
电极箔→水合处理→初段化成→中段化成→安定化处理→终段化成一→安
定化处理→终段化成二→安定化处理→卷取
上位机是化成生产线监控系统的控制**,其控制网络拓扑结构如图 1 所
示。它是由数据采集从站和数据主站构成的。
(1)数据采集从站
本系统对生产车间 22 条生产线、高压、低压及外围设施采用数据采集从站
对信号进行采集。从站包括软件和硬件两部分,硬件部分主要采用 SMART 200 PLC
加各种 I/O、A/D 模块组成,并配有雷击和浪涌电压防护模块。
系统能监视、记录铝箔生产线重要的生产数据。本系统负责目前生产线需要
采集的较多 45 个数字表头的数据。
每个采集从站可扩展一个 485 接口,可以和其它设备进行 MODBUS 通讯。
模块采集数据可通过 PLC 的以太网接口将所有的系统数据通过工业以太网
传送至上位机。
(2)数据采集主站
1.上位机采用台式电脑作为监控主机,可储存数年的历史数据。
2.对于各种持续的数据,可以实时曲线和历史曲线的方式直观显示,作为衡量生
产线性能的依据。
3.所有故障报警及预置目标值(SV 值)修改均有记录。
4.通过终端程序和双网卡将工厂的局域网和工厂监控网络分开,保证现场数据的
安全与高效。客户可通过外网随时监控现场数据。
方案确定
本项目中采用西门子 S7-200 SMART PLC 作为主控制器,采用上位机的显示
器作为人机交互接口。S7-200 SMART 的 CPU 集成了以太网接口和 1 个 RS485 接
口。RS485 通信口支持自由口通信,以太网接口不仅支持程序调试功能,还能与
触摸屏和计算机进行通信,轻松组网。S7-200 SMART 配备了西门子**高速处
理芯片,可以轻松满足化成生产线监控系统的控制要求。
本系统采用 CPU SR40 采集生产线上所有仪表的数据,然后再把所有 PLC 的
数据都通过以太网传送给上位机,每个 CPU 均配备了 RS485 通信板。CPU SR40
具有 24 点输入,16 点输出,支持自由口通信,完全可以满足化成生产线的控制
要求。
(1)化成电源控制程序
通过采集电源的状态、电压、电流等数据和上位机的控制,做一个调节的闭
环的自动化控制。
(2)化成线通信程序
PLC 不仅要采集生产线上所有仪表和状态信号,而且要接收上位机下达的控
制任务。在一个化成生产线监控系统中,PLC 与上位机的实时通信很关键,否则
会影响到整个系统的运行效率及安全。影响实时通信的因素有:通信仪表的数量、
通信波特率、通信介质、通信协议及通信网络结构等。
其中 RS485 自由口通信协议及程序的实现尤其重要。由于 AIBUS 通信协议中
主站对从站的读写操作是分开的,在监控系统中,主站不仅需要得到化成电源的
实时状态,还需要把控制任务实时发送到化成电源,在化成电源数量比较多的系
统中,如果采用读写操作分开的通讯协议,那么通信的实时性就会明显降低。
本项目为了达到操作的实时性,采用了一次发送和接收的方式,提高了通信
效率。
参考 AIBUS 协议,通过自由口协议编写的控制和通信程序实现了类似的功能
和工业以太网实现了同时操作多台电源的控制和实时监控。
应用体会
S7-200 SMART 控制器可扩展至 2 个 RS485 通信口,均支持自由口通信,
很好地满足了化成生产线对 RS485 通信口的数量要求。同时,本地集成的以太网
口支持编程调试、触摸屏通讯等功能,使用 1 根网线就可以实现编程调试工作,
不必走到每台 PLC 旁边去调试程序,从而提工作效率。
机型丰富,更多选择
提供不同类型、I/O点数丰富的CPU模块,单体I/O点数较高可达60点,可满足大部分小型自动化设备的控制需求。另外,CPU模块配备标准型和经济型供用户选择,对于不同的应用需求,产品配置更加灵活,较大限度的控制成本。
PROFIBUS 通信
使用EM DP01扩展模块可以将S7-200 SMART SR/ST CPU做为PROFIBUS-DP从站连接
到PROFIBUS通信网络。通过模块上的旋转开关可以设置PROFIBUS-DP从站地址。该
模块支持9600波特到12M波特之间的任一PROFIBUS波特率,较大允许244输入字
节和244输出字节。